Details
-
Improvement
-
Status: Resolved
-
Major
-
Resolution: Won't Fix
-
None
-
None
-
None
-
Enabled setting clientId and tenantId for ADL MsiTokenProvider. This allows MSI authentication on VMs with attached multiple MSIs.
Description
AdlFileSystem is currently using a deprecated constructor for MsiTokenProvider, only passing a port setting which is not used anymore.
The purpose of this improvement is to update AdlFileSystem to pass optional clientId and tenantId to MsiTokenProvider. This can ultimately enable MSI authentication on VMs with attached multiple MSIs.